5 messaggi dal 22 giugno 2001
Ciao a tutti, ho provato a registrare mediante apposito programmino Microsoft (Javareg.exe) le mie classi Java. La registrazione, stando al programmino microsoft, è andata a buon fine. Peccato che quando scrivo "Set Pippo = Server.CreateObject("Pippo")" ricevo uno splendido errore "Server.CreateObject Failed" con motivazione "ClassFactory cannot supply requested class".

Qualcuno ha una benchè minima idea di come fixare la cosa?

Informazioni aggiuntive sono:
* Le mie classi Java sono in %systemroot%/java/trustlib
* Sono state compilate con Javac.exe
* La classe "Pippo" richiama un'altra classe "Pluto" anch'essa in %systemroot%/java/trustlib

Grazie 10000

Filippo


1.605 messaggi dal 06 settembre 2002
non sò se fà al tuo caso ma prova a registrare le classi con regsvr32

dalla funzione run (start)

scrivi regsvr32 cercorsoClasse


FORZA LA MAGICA ROMA

FORZA LA MAGICA ROMA
5 messaggi dal 22 giugno 2001
sono quasi riuscito a fare tutto, ho registrato la classe con javareg invece di regsvr32, il mio problema ora risiede nel fare i cambiamenti (fine tuning delle classi). Il magico windows si tiene in memoria la classe istanziata in ASP e anche cancellando la classe continua a darmi le funzioni della classe cancellata.

Please help me!!

con

set nomeclasse = nothing

ti rimane ancora in memoria?

--
Daniele Bochicchio
<b>Content manager di http://www.aspitalia.com</b>
http://store.aspitalia.com/scheda.asp?codice=255
ASP 3 per esempi - il mio libro

Daniele Bochicchio | ASPItalia.com | Libri
Chief Operating Officer@iCubed
Microsoft Regional Director & MVP
40 messaggi dal 14 dicembre 2001
Ciao scusa se mi intrometto ... io ho lo stesso problema ho registrato una classe come hai fatto tu però continua a darmi il tuo stesso errore:
------------------------------------------------------------
Tipo di errore:
Oggetto Server, ASP 0177 (0x80040111)
ClassFactory non può fornire la classe richiesta.
------------------------------------------------------------
Tu come hai risolto ?
Ti metto anche il mio codice da dove la richiamo:
------------------------------------------------------------
Set Logon = Server.CreateObject("LogonManager")
Logon.input("pippo")

Grazie Ciao

- Al mio segnale scatenate l'inferno -
Il compilatore è il jc di Microsoft o Sun?

"This message was written using 100% recycled electrons"
40 messaggi dal 14 dicembre 2001
Grazie per l'interessamente .. comunque è sun !!

- Al mio segnale scatenate l'inferno -
Io ho avuto problemi col compilatore di Sun cercando di far andare classi java sotto asp. Sono dovuto ricorrere al MS Compiler altrimenti il codice mi dava problemi di moniker.

"This message was written using 100% recycled electrons"

Torna al forum | Feed RSS

ASPItalia.com non è responsabile per il contenuto dei messaggi presenti su questo servizio, non avendo nessun controllo sui messaggi postati nei propri forum, che rappresentano l'espressione del pensiero degli autori.